2018 Bunce Travel Award

On behalf of the ARLIS/NA Midstates Chapter, the Travel Awards Committee is
pleased to offer the William C. Bunce Travel Award

 of $600 for travel to the ARLIS/NA Annual Conference in Salt Lake City,
March 26-30, 2019.

This award is given in honor of William C. Bunce, who served as the
Director of the Kohler Art Library at the University of Wisconsin-Madison
from 1966 to 1999. The William C. Bunce ARLIS/NA-Midstates Travel Award is
intended to support a Midstates Chapter member’s professional development
by providing funding to attend the ARLIS/NA annual conference. Only
ARLIS/NA-Midstates Chapter members are eligible. Information about becoming
a member of ARLIS/NA and the regional chapter is available at the ARLIS/NA
website <http://www.arlisna.org/join.taf> and the ARLIS/NA-Midstates
Chapter website <http://midstates.arlisna.org/membership.html>.

This Travel Award will be granted based on one or more of the following
criteria: financial need; level of chapter participation; first-time
attendance; and contribution to the conference.

To apply for this award please submit a letter of application addressing
relevant award criteria and how you will benefit from attending the ARLIS/NA
Annual Conference in Salt Lake City. You must also indicate the level of
funding you expect to receive from your institution and include a current
resume or CV. *Please send applications via email to **Alyssa Vincent
([log in to unmask] <[log in to unmask]>). *

[image: https://ssl.gstatic.com/ui/v1/icons/mail/images/cleardot.gif]The
application deadline is *Monday, January 14 at 5pm CST. *The recipient will
be notified by Monday, January 28 and will receive the award by the Friday,
February 22 early rate registration deadline for the conference. The
recipient must confirm in writing that they will be able to use the award
for conference attendance. Recipients will not be eligible to apply again
for three years. After receiving the award and attending the conference,
the recipient must submit a short report indicating the value of the award
to their professional development.
